Exclude from start of page footer

When the print engine needs to calculate the space on a sheet of paper that can be used for detail and group sections, the size of the page footers is important for this calculation. The total height of the page footer sections is subtracted from the paper size. If a report has multiple page footer sections, there is a significant chance that one or more of these sections are conditionally used. If not all page footers are used on each page, the sum of their heights would take too much from the paper size. This option tells the engine to skip the selected section from the height calculation.

To ensure there is enough space for the footer(s), make sure that either the largest page footer is used in the height calculation or that the sum of the page footer heights is sufficient to print the conditionally used page footers.
